WebSep 18, 2024 · Solution: the ramp or inclined plane has an unknown angle and must be determined. Assume the positive x x -axis to be down the ramp. (a) The only force that pulls the puck down the slope and accelerates it is the component of weight force parallel to the inclined plane, w_ {\parallel}=mg\sin\theta w∥ = mgsinθ. WebApr 8, 2024 · Pure rolling is a combination of translation and rotational motion, in which the point of contact comes to rest instantly because there is no sliding. The translational motion of a body is the motion of its centre of mass. During a body's rolling motion, the surfaces in contact are temporarily deformed. A finite area of both bodies comes into ...
